Subject: Bigview cut-over complete

Plugin authors: the Bigview diff engine cut-over finished last night. Legacy hook API is gone; use the v3 interface only. Large-file streaming is now default, so avoid buffering whole payloads. Rebuild and republish against the new manifest. The runtime settings your plugins will see are listed below.

config for fawif-tajop:
wenath:
  pin: 8088
  tenant: gorwyn
  seal: seal_41405b34
  metrics_host: metrics.wenath.nelvrosys.corp
  standby_team: wenael
  escalation: ulaix-kelath
  nonce: 5d2add

Step 4 — Shipping Driftpane (our big-file diff viewer)

Build the chunked-rendering bundle first; Driftpane streams diffs in 2MB slices, so don't skip the worker assets or huge files will just spin forever. Run the smoke test against the 500MB fixture in the perf folder — if scrolling stutters, bump the slice cache before releasing. When everything passes, you're ready to sign the artifact. Paste the deploy key below so the uploader can authenticate.

deploy key for kagup-bageg: bky4_6i6U

Internal Memo — Revised Sales-Commission Scheme

To the finance team: effective next quarter, Corvane Systems moves to a tiered commission model replacing the flat rate. Tiers are set at quota attainment of 80%, 100%, and 120%, with accelerators above the top band. Please update accrual models and payout calendars accordingly; clawback terms are unchanged. The strategic rationale behind this change is summarised in the note below.

board note of yajop-kajef: Gross margin on Ralwyn came in at 15 percent against a plan of 20 percent. Only 9 of the 100 pilot accounts renewed Ralwyn, so a churn review is set for April 1.